Aspire Tower, also known as The Torch Doha, is a 300-meter-tall skyscraper located in the Aspire Zone of Doha, Qatar. Completed in 2007 for the 15th Asian Games, it is the tallest structure in Qatar and serves as a luxury hotel with 51 floors. Designed by architect Hadi Simaan, the tower symbolizes modern engineering and is known for its torch-like shape, which was intended to represent the Games’ flame.
Visitor Fee
There is no specific entry fee to view the building from the outside. However, access to some areas such as the panoramic restaurant, revolving lounge, or hotel facilities requires being a guest or making a reservation, which comes with applicable charges.
